Dubai: Abu Dhabi National Oil Co. will boost crude supply to customers to more than 4 million barrels a day in April as Opec’s third-biggest producer joins an oil supply battle sparked by Saudi Arabia and Russia.

Adnoc is also accelerating plans to boost output to 5 million barrels a day, the company said in a statement.

Supplying that much crude to the market would mean adding more than 1 million barrels a day to what the United Arab Emirates pumped in February, according to Bloomberg data.
